Sedimentary basins are the primary hosts of global hydrocarbon resources. Understanding their formation, structure, and petroleum systems is critical for successful exploration and production.

This Sedimentary Basin Exploration and Hydrocarbon Potential Training Course introduces participants to basin classification, tectonic settings, stratigraphy, petroleum system elements, and exploration techniques. It integrates geophysical, geochemical, and geological data to evaluate hydrocarbon prospects.

Through lectures, case studies, and practical exercises, participants will develop skills in basin analysis and hydrocarbon potential assessment, preparing them to contribute effectively to exploration projects.
